Model Shop

Model shops in the UK are either one of 2 types... Modern and well laid out. Or old and a collection of strange and wonderful models in faded boxes. Germany is no exception... Except that this model shop has a back room, that is only for regular customers... Seems we're an exception :) a veritable Aladdin's cave of goodies... One of which is this microscopic model petrol engine. Fully working at 0.01"^2 displacement, and runs at a astonishing 20'000rpm! For scale that's my index finger in the picture :)
